Understanding Steam Carpet Cleaning: A Comprehensive Overview
Steam carpet cleaning is a powerful method that utilizes high-temperature water extraction to deeply clean carpets and rugs. This process involves infusing hot water into the fibers, lifting dirt, stains, and grime from deep within the fabric. The water, often heated to temperatures between 180-210°F (82-99°C), is then extracted along with the accumulated debris, leaving your carpets fresh, clean, and free of allergens.
This technique, also known as hot water extraction, goes beyond the surface cleaning provided by traditional vacuum cleaners. By employing steam, it effectively breaks down and removes stubborn stains, pet messes, and even odors. Moreover, it’s a popular choice for allergy sufferers due to its ability to kill germs, mites, and other allergens trapped in carpet fibers. Step-by-Step Process of a Premium Steam Clean Carpet Service
The process begins with a thorough inspection to understand the carpet’s condition and any specific areas requiring attention. Next, professional technicians prepare the space by moving furniture and protecting floor edges, ensuring a safe and efficient clean. The heart of the service is high-temperature water extraction, where powerful steam cleaners infuse hot water into the carpet fibres, dissolving dirt and grime. This deep cleaning method is especially effective for allergy sufferers as it removes allergens, dust mites, and pet dander, promoting a healthier indoor environment. After the extraction, the extracted dirty water is vacuumed away, leaving the carpet fresh and clean. A final rinse with clean water ensures optimal results, and the carpet is left to dry naturally, ready for foot traffic once again. Maintenance Tips and Frequently Asked Questions
Maintenance Tips for Optimal Steam Cleaning:
Regular maintenance is key to keeping your carpets looking their best after a professional steam clean. For optimal results, avoid walking on the carpet immediately after cleaning to allow it to fully dry. This process naturally removes any remaining moisture and prevents potential damage or musty odors from building up. Vacuuming at least once a week with a powerful vacuum cleaner can also help extend the life of your steamed carpets by removing loose dirt and debris that might have been loosened during the cleaning process.
Frequently Asked Questions:
Q: How often should I steam clean my carpets? A: The frequency depends on several factors, including foot traffic, pets, and allergies. For homes without significant issues, twice a year is generally recommended.
Q: Is steam cleaning effective for allergy relief? A: Absolutely! Steam cleaning helps remove allergens like dust mites, pet dander, and pollen from deep within your carpets, making it an excellent choice for allergy sufferers. The high-temperature water extraction used in the process effectively reduces airborne allergens.
